Takasugi makes his first appearance in this arc when he attends a festival held honoring the amanto's first arrival. According to Imai Nobume, Takasugi seeks to destroy what Yoshida Shouyou left behind. This hatred seems to have originated from the loss of his mentor Yoshida Shouyou, as Takasugi wants to destroy the world that took away his teacher. Takasugi also has a burning hatred for the new world that came to be after the Amanto settled down. He is ruthless, and does not hesitate to punish insubordination with death, as Nizou experienced first-hand when he realized that Takasugi was seriously aiming to kill him during the Benizakura chapter. Later, after reconciling with Gintoki, he stops using his bandages, his hair also gets longer in Rakuyou arc. He has also been seen playing the shamisen and wearing a sedge hat. He likes to smoke a thin pipe called kiseru. His left eye is bandaged, as he lost his eye during the Joui war and he is usually seen wearing a purple yukata with yellow butterflies.
